Serving 380 students in grades Prekindergarten-Kindergarten, Moss Elementary School ranks in the bottom 50% of all schools in Texas for overall test scores (math proficiency is bottom 50%, and reading proficiency is bottom 50%).
The percentage of students achieving proficiency in math is 65-69% (which is lower than the Texas state average of 78%). The percentage of students achieving proficiency in reading/language arts is 60-64% (which is lower than the Texas state average of 72%).
The student-teacher ratio of 18:1 is higher than the Texas state level of 14:1.
Minority enrollment is 82%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is higher than the Texas state average of 76% (majority Hispanic).

School Overview

Moss Elementary School's student population of 380 students has declined by 18% over five school years.
The teacher population of 21 teachers has declined by 22% over five school years.
